NDAQ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2025 in Review

931 of the 7,457 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Nasdaq (NDAQ) for Q1 2025, worth a combined $36.9B — down 0.33% from $37B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 124 funds opened new NDAQ positions and 83 closed out — a net gain of 41 holders — while 387 added to existing stakes and 292 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Bank of America, adding an estimated $184M. The largest seller was Wellington Management Group, cutting an estimated $175M.
